How the System Works in Everyday Wauwatosa Driving
The 360° View Monitor uses cameras placed at the front, sides, and rear of the vehicle, then displays a comprehensive image on the center screen. See-through View can superimpose a forward-looking field so you can navigate around low obstacles or tight corners that would ordinarily be hidden from the driver’s seat. Trailer Hitch View adds another layer of practicality if you tow small recreational gear when properly equipped. In short, it’s made for real life—narrow lanes, angled curbs, and busy lots included.

See-through View vs. Traditional Camera Feeds
Traditional feeds give you a fixed rear or front view; the CX-90’s See-through View creates an extended perspective that approximates what’s in front of the hood and along the sides. This helps you visualize obstacles like parking blocks, low posts, or dipped curbs before they’re in contact range. It’s particularly helpful when inching forward out of a tight parallel space onto a busy street—exactly the kind of scenario that makes Wauwatosa driving exciting on crowded days.
Because the 360° View Monitor integrates with the CX-90’s overall system, the transitions between camera angles feel smooth. You’re not toggling through confusing menus; the system knows what’s most helpful as you shift or steer, and presents it intuitively.

Towing Alignment Made Easier
If your weekends include hauling bikes or small gear when properly equipped, Trailer Hitch View helps you line up without a spotter. Seeing the hitch and coupler on screen allows you to back up with precision, saving repeated jumps in and out of the driver’s seat. The CX-90’s rear-biased architecture and standard i-Activ AWD® add to this planted, controlled feeling while maneuvering at low speeds.
Even if you tow infrequently, having a clear on-screen view protects your bumper and hitch components from bump-and-check mistakes. For families who mix errands with recreation, this level of simple alignment support is hard to give up once you’ve tried it.
